His older stuff is a lot more early 00s Ninja Tune era jazz breaks and turntablism lite, right? Not saying that's a bad thing but this stuff sounds like he's progressed a lot.

 

Personally this is one of the best albums I've heard this year. I get the vibe that it's too slick, pretty, and arguably too mainstream for it's own good (kind of in that "pretty advertisement / artsy big budget video with hot model" territory a lot of future beats / future bass music gives off) BUT it's done well. There's a high quality and depth to his production that makes this stand out and more in Gold Panda, Four Tet, Floating Points territory.
